The Symbolism and Significance of Sweet Peas
Sweet peas carry a rich symbolism, often associated with blissful pleasure, gratitude, and farewell. In the language of flowers, giving sweet peas can be a way to say "thank you for a lovely time" or to express delicate and gentle sentiments. This makes them an ideal motif for gifts, especially for occasions like birthdays, anniversaries, or as a simple token of appreciation. The flower's association with farewell also gives it a poignant touch, making it suitable for remembrance projects or as a symbol of fond memories.
Incorporating sweet peas into your embroidery adds not only visual appeal but also a layer of meaningful expression. You can customize the colors and design to further convey your intended message. For example, using pastel shades can evoke a sense of tenderness and gentleness, while brighter hues can express joy and celebration. Realistic Sweet Pea Embroidery
For those who appreciate lifelike detail, realistic sweet pea embroidery is a fantastic option. This style aims to capture the intricate beauty of sweet peas as they appear in nature. Realistic embroidery often involves using a variety of stitches and shading techniques to create depth and dimension. You might use satin stitch to fill the petals, French knots for delicate details, and long and short stitch to blend colors seamlessly. Achieving a realistic look requires careful attention to color selection and stitch placement, but the results are truly stunning. These designs are perfect for creating heirloom-quality pieces that showcase the natural elegance of sweet peas. They can be used on wall art, cushions, or even as framed pieces to add a touch of botanical beauty to your home.

Vintage and Traditional Sweet Pea Motifs
Vintage and traditional sweet pea motifs evoke a sense of nostalgia and timeless charm. These designs often draw inspiration from historical embroidery patterns and vintage floral illustrations. Think delicate lines, muted colors, and intricate detailing. Vintage sweet pea embroidery is perfect for adding a touch of old-world elegance to your projects. Common stitches used in this style include stem stitch for outlining, lazy daisy stitch for petals, and French knots for delicate accents.
You can find inspiration from antique embroidery samplers, vintage botanical prints, and historical textiles. Consider using fabrics like linen or cotton in natural hues to enhance the vintage feel. These designs are beautiful for embellishing heirloom pieces, such as tablecloths, napkins, or framed art. Essential Stitches for Sweet Pea Embroidery
Mastering a few essential stitches can make a world of difference in your sweet pea embroidery projects. These stitches form the foundation for creating beautiful and intricate designs. Let's take a look at some must-know stitches that will help you bring your sweet pea creations to life.
Satin Stitch
The satin stitch is a classic embroidery stitch used to fill shapes with smooth, solid color. It's perfect for creating the petals of sweet peas, giving them a lush and vibrant appearance. To work the satin stitch, bring your needle up at one edge of the shape and down at the opposite edge, creating a long, straight stitch. Repeat this process, placing each stitch close to the previous one, until the entire area is filled. For best results, use short stitches and keep them parallel to each other. This will create a smooth and even surface.
French Knot
French knots are tiny, knotted stitches that add texture and detail to your embroidery. They're ideal for creating the delicate centers of sweet peas or adding subtle accents to your designs. To make a French knot, bring your needle up through the fabric and wrap the thread around the needle once or twice. Hold the wrapped thread in place with your finger, insert the needle back into the fabric close to the point where it emerged, and pull the thread through gently. The resulting knot will add a touch of elegance to your sweet pea embroidery.
Stem Stitch
The stem stitch is a versatile outlining stitch that's perfect for creating the stems and vines of sweet peas. It provides a clean and defined line, adding structure to your design. To work the stem stitch, bring your needle up through the fabric and take a small stitch forward. Bring the needle up again halfway back along the previous stitch, keeping the thread to one side of the needle. Continue this process, creating a slightly overlapping line that resembles a stem. The stem stitch can also be used to add delicate details to petals and leaves.
Long and Short Stitch
The long and short stitch, also known as thread painting, is a technique used to blend colors and create smooth shading in your embroidery. It's perfect for achieving a realistic look in your sweet pea petals. This stitch involves alternating long and short stitches within the same area to create a gradual transition between colors. Start by outlining the area you want to fill and then work rows of long and short stitches, varying the lengths to create a natural, blended effect. The long and short stitch is an advanced technique, but with practice, you can achieve stunning results.

Choosing the Right Fabric and Threads
The foundation of any embroidery project is the fabric and threads you choose. For sweet pea embroidery, natural fabrics like linen, cotton, and muslin are excellent choices. These fabrics are easy to work with and provide a smooth surface for stitching. When it comes to threads, cotton embroidery floss is a popular option due to its vibrant colors and durability. You can also experiment with silk threads for a luxurious sheen or wool threads for a more textured look. The key is to choose threads that complement your fabric and design.
Consider the weight and weave of your fabric when selecting threads. Heavier fabrics can handle thicker threads, while lighter fabrics may require finer threads to prevent puckering. Always test your fabric and thread combination on a scrap piece before starting your main project to ensure the stitches look smooth and even.
Transferring Your Design Accurately
Accurately transferring your design onto the fabric is crucial for a successful embroidery project. There are several methods you can use, depending on your preference and the type of fabric. One common method is using a water-soluble transfer pen. Simply trace your design onto the fabric, and the ink will wash away with water after you've finished stitching. Another option is using a light box or tracing paper. Place your fabric over the design on a light box and trace the lines onto the fabric with a pencil. For darker fabrics, you can use dressmaker's carbon paper or iron-on transfer pens.
Whichever method you choose, make sure your design is clear and easy to follow. Take your time and be precise when transferring the lines, as this will guide your stitching. If you're working with a complex design, consider breaking it down into smaller sections to make the transfer process more manageable.
Mastering Color Blending and Shading Techniques
Color blending and shading are essential techniques for creating realistic and visually appealing sweet pea embroidery. By using a variety of colors and stitching techniques, you can add depth and dimension to your designs. One effective technique is using the long and short stitch, as mentioned earlier, to create gradual transitions between colors. Another approach is to use different shades of the same color to create subtle shading effects.
Experiment with blending threads by using two different colors in your needle simultaneously. This creates a beautiful marbled effect that's perfect for petals and leaves. Pay attention to the direction of your stitches when shading, as this can impact the overall look of your design. For example, stitching in a circular motion can create a rounded effect, while stitching in straight lines can add a sense of structure.
